Northern Zambia Safari Circuit
Begin with arranged air access to remote North Luangwa, then follow the seasonal road route through Mpika to Bangweulu's shoebill and black-lechwe wetlands, Kasanka's forest and bat migration, and Serenje.

How the route joins up
Travel times and access inside protected areas vary with weather, water, park rules, and track conditions. Confirm current guidance locally.
Lusaka → North Luangwa National Park
Use an arranged light-air transfer into North Luangwa. The operating airstrip, intermediate stops, and schedule depend on the confirmed Safari plan.
North Luangwa National Park → Mpika
Follow the remote western park route through Mano Gate to the Great North Road. This stage is strongly seasonal and can take much longer after difficult conditions.
Mpika → Bangweulu Wetlands
Travel south on the Great North Road, then west through the Lavushi Manda approach. Rain and flood levels determine the final road or boat transfer.
Bangweulu Wetlands → Kasanka National Park
Use the mapped track connection toward Kasanka only in suitable dry-season conditions. Confirm the current route before setting out; outside that window, a different transfer plan is required.
Kasanka National Park → Serenje
Leave through Mulembo Gate and continue to Serenje for the Great North Road and onward travel.
